Why are dna and dna replication important

DNA is important because it is a molecule that encodes the genetic instructions used in the development and functioning of every living thing.

DNA replication is important because cells multiply through replication, and if DNA could not replicate then cell replication would not be possible. This is important for growth and healing.

Without DNA and DNA replication almost all living organisms would not exist.
